There has been a lot of discussion on Java 5 support for Struts Action
2, and from my reading of the comments, we have settled on a path, but
I want to formalize it in a vote to ensure we are all on the same page.
I vote we develop Struts Action 2 with Java 5, taking advantage of it
where ever we can. At the same time, we should use Retroweaver to
build jars that will run in a 1.4 JVM. For those that aren't
familiar, Retroweaver supports conversion of an impressive amount of
Java 5 features and language changes. In summary, Retroweaver
supports [1]:
* generics
* extended for loops
* static imports
* autoboxing/unboxing
* varargs
* enumerations
* annotations
Therefore, our development philosophy will be to take _full_ advantage
of Java 5, but provide a working jar for Java 1.4, however, we can't
guarantee every Struts Action 2.0 feature will be available to Java
1.4 users.
